HUNTERXHUNTER

SUMMARY - Young Gon leaves Whale Island to take the annual Hunter Exam, the exam makes you a hunter with many advantages. He creates great friends on the way and one of them ends up being his best friend and companion for the rest of the anime. Killua and Gon travel together through different arcs with the ultimate goal to find Gon's dad who is one of the world's best hunter.

Yona of the Dawn

Summary- Yona was a pampered princess until her father was killed by her childhood friend. When the country turns against her she escapes with her other longtime friend, Hak. They set out on a journey to find the four dragons that served the original master.

The summary of the anime makes it seem very clique and average, but the characters are designed so that they bring more to the story. It feels like the plot is very straightforward, finding the 4 dragons and reclaiming the throne but Yona grows so much in the process that it's more interesting to watch.

In the beginning of the anime she disobeyed her father and wished to receive whatever she wanted. The brutal struggles of being a fugitive changed her as she sees Hak constantly risking his life in order to protect her. This makes her want to get stronger so she can defend herself.
               
Personally Yona didn't feel like a heroine who tried too hard to get stronger; she did push herself but the balance was nicely done. Her experience had turned her into a strong, kind, independent woman. The anime ends short on that, but the manga shows her travelling with the dragons, continually helping the kingdom by aiding the commoners.
